APPARATUS AND METHOD FOR PRELOADING A PLURALITY OF FEED TYPES OF A FEED MIX FOR LIVESTOCK AND METHOD FOR PREPARING FEED MIXES
Preloading a plurality of feed types of a feed mix for livestock in a mixing plant. Feed types are conveyed towards a mixer. Bunkers selectively discharge one of the feed types on a loading conveyor. A controller controls a preloading weight of the feed types to be discharged onto the loading conveyor. Feed types are individually discharge onto dump spots of the loading conveyor at the bunkers and terminate when a predetermined total weight is reached or interrupt when a maximum preloading capacity is reached or feed reaches the end of the loading conveyor. Feed types may be individually discharged from the bunkers onto the dump spots and the main component loaded into the mixer by a loading vehicle, such that the weight of the main portion and the weight of the supplemental portion add up to a programmed total weight of the main component.
An apparatus for loading feed types of feed mix for livestock, comprises bunkers configured for selectively loading one or more of the feed types in a mixer for preparing the feed mix; and a control system programmed to load the feed types in the mixer as a supplemental portion of a main component of the feed mix, loaded into the mixer with a loading vehicle, such that a weight of a main portion of the main component of the feed mix and a weight of the supplemental portion add up to a programmed weight of the main component. Discharging and conveying of the feed types is controlled by a computer program which sequentially moves dump spots of the loading vehicle under the bunkers and individually controls feed type discharge depending on a preloading plan.
Fodder mixing wagon with a mixing container and at least one mixing member arranged rotatable therein for fodder components and a sensor system arranged to co-rotate on the mixing member for examining at least one of the fodder components and/or a fodder mixture formed therefrom. A data transmission system with a transmitter a receiver which are associated with one another in a co-rotating and not co-rotating arrangement for wireless data transmission to and/or from the sensor system; and/or an electrical generator for supplying power to the sensor system. The transmitter and receiver are arranged such that the wireless data transmission is within the mixing container; and the generator is arranged on the stator side to co-rotate with the mixing member and on the rotor side is coupled not to co-rotate. Data transmission is provided with a low transmission power. Inductive data and power transmission may be used.
A fodder mixing wagon includes a mixing container having a mixing member for fodder components arranged therein. A sensor system is arranged to co-rotate on the mixing member for examining the fodder components and/or fodder mixture. A data transmission system with at least one transmitter and at least one associated receiver are arranged such that wireless data transmission takes place entirely within the mixing container. A generator arranged on the stator side to co-rotate with the mixing member and on the rotor side, is coupled for non co-rotation co- rotate to enable simple and reliable data transmission with a comparatively low transmission power.

Agricultural transport vehicle with weighing system
Agricultural transport vehicle, in particular mixer-wagon, having at least one hold for agricultural bulk goods and at least one weighing device, in particular a load cell and/or a weighing bar, for detecting the weight of load in the hold; having at least one inertial measuring unit for measuring an acceleration and/or orientation of the agricultural transport vehicle, in particular the hold; and having at least one computing unit which is designed to compensate a raw signal of the weighing device with respect to the measured acceleration and/or orientation.

Provided in a livestock feeding system (A) with a feed preparation area (1) containing at least one storage (8, 9), a livestock stable (2, 3) which is connected via driving routes (4) to the feed preparation area (1), and a robot (R) which comprises a variable speed electric drive (14) controllable by a frequency transformer (13) and a battery (B), and which is optionally connectable to a power supply at least in the feed preparation area (1), is a power rail line (S1) in the feed preparation area (1) routed past the storages (8, 9) and a docking device (6) to the power rail line (S1). As the battery (B), the robot (R) contains a high-voltage DC battery which is connected to an intermediate circuit (18) of the frequency transformer (13).
